Seri Muka is a Malay and Nyonya kuih made of glutinous rice and pandan leaves. They are so pretty, with natural green color and cut into small pieces. More importantly, seri muka is absolutely delightful—sweet, laden with coconut milk, with a nice sticky texture. They go extremely well with a cup of coffee in the morning, or as an afternoon.

The ingredients needed to make Seri Muka (Malay Ethnic Cuisine):
  1. Take Glutinous Rice
  2. Take 500 g rice soaked overnight
  3. Make ready 500 ml coconut milk
  4. Prepare to taste Salt
  5. Prepare Pandan Layer
  6. Prepare 150 ml Pandan Juice
  7. Prepare 150 g sugar
  8. Take 3 large eggs
  9. Make ready 100 g wheat flour
  10. Get 400 ml coconut milk
  11. Make ready to taste Salt

Steps to make Seri Muka (Malay Ethnic Cuisine):
  1. Drain the rice, place it in a cake baking tray or any mold that has the similar depth. Add one pandan leaf. Mix the coconut milk with salt and add to the rice. The coconut milk should be very slightly above the rice. So watch it when you pour. Place it in the steamer for 25 mins or until it's cooked
  2. Now once the rice is cooked stir well, remove the pandan leaf and press compactly on the baking mold. This is to ensure when we pour the pandan layer it does not slip through the rice
  3. For the pandan layer. Add all the ingriedients and pulse in a blender. On top of a steamer, stir the mixture until it becomes thick. Then pour over the hot rice. Steam another 30 minutes.
  4. Cool it down before you can cut. Consume within 24 hours as it will go bad quickly. You may store in the fridge but the rice will become hard.
